[Bug 44874] Re: auto smbfs mount in /etc/fstab causes hald hang at boot
If worked here - at least for now (I restarted the system a few times without problems). In my opinion, this work-around also points to a timing issue between starting the ethernet network, starting the samba system and mouting the network shares. Most of most of the above mentioned suggestions influence the point in time when a specific service is started: putting smbfs in /etc/modules: early in the boot process mounting shares in /etc/rc.local: late in the boot process pre-up sleep 5 in /etc/network/interfaces: give something else more time to finish This would also be consistent with my observation that the /etc/modules variant sometimes work and sometimes it doesn't. My guess: This problem is a hick-up in the multi-threaed booting process introduced sometime during the latest Dapper pre-releases. -- auto smbfs mount in /etc/fstab causes hald hang at boot https://launchpad.net/bugs/44874 -- ubuntu-bugs mailing list ubuntu-bugs@lists.ubuntu.com https://lists.ubuntu.com/mailman/listinfo/ubuntu-bugs

[Bug 44931] Re: CUPS tries to auto-generate SSL key, fails
Merely creating the directory with sudo mkdir /etc/cups/ssl sudo chown cupsys /etc/cups/ssl was enough for me to get it running. Creating the certificate and key was a matter of seconds. However, to integrate our snakeoil SSL certificate support, we need to do the following (as root): mkdir /etc/cups/ssl ln -s /etc/ssl/certs/ssl-cert-snakeoil.pem /etc/cups/ssl/server.crt ln -s /etc/ssl/private/ssl-cert-snakeoil.key /etc/cups/ssl/server.key adduser cupsys ssl-cert and then restart cupsys. ** Changed in: cupsys (Ubuntu) Assignee: (unassigned) = Martin Pitt Status: Confirmed = In Progress -- CUPS tries to auto-generate SSL key, fails https://launchpad.net/bugs/44931 -- ubuntu-bugs mailing list ubuntu-bugs@lists.ubuntu.com https://lists.ubuntu.com/mailman/listinfo/ubuntu-bugs

[Bug 49572] Re: dependancy installs apache even when appache2 is already installed
This is not really a bug. Apt is just not smart enough to install the dependancy with less missed dependencies. # apt-cache show phpldapadmin | grep DependsDepends: apache | httpd, php4-ldap | php5-ldap, php4 (= 4.1.0) | php4-cgi (= 4.1.0) | libapache2-mod-php4 | php5 | php5-cgi | libapache2-mod-php5, debconf (= 0.5) | debconf-2.0 So, if none of php4-ldap or php5-ldap is installed, apt goes for php4-ldap since it's first in the list. I haven't figured out why this comes down to pulling in apache-common then, but on chatting with the package maintainer he agreed to change the order and offer php5 first. He might need to double check with phpldap admin users for issues with php5 as opposed to php4. -- dependancy installs apache even when appache2 is already installed https://launchpad.net/bugs/49572 -- ubuntu-bugs mailing list ubuntu-bugs@lists.ubuntu.com https://lists.ubuntu.com/mailman/listinfo/ubuntu-bugs
